Vettel bemused by Mercedes' ‘weird' DAS system
Sebastian Vettel was left bemused by Mercedes' DAS (dual-axis steering) system, which was uncovered on Thursday during the second day of Formula 1 testing. The system allows the driver to change the toe of the front-wheels by pushing or pulling the steering wheel – whilst the exact benefit is unknown, it's believed it could improve tyre life as well as increased straight-line speed and stability without impacting cornering speeds. The FIA has reportedly given the system the okay according to Mercedes technical chief James Allison.
